Best place to get … WebRaystown Lake In PA Raystown Lake is the largest lake in PA entirely in the state; larger ones are shared in two or more states. The lake is a 29,000-acre project with an 8,000-acre lake, 12 public access areas, beach area, boat launches, picnic areas, campgrounds, small waterpark, marina concession stands, trails, hunting, and incredible fishing opportunities. graeme searle western australia
